Building a Nest in a Tree

When it comes to building a nest in a tree, there are several important considerations to keep in mind. Choosing the right tree, assessing its health, and selecting a suitable location are all crucial steps in creating a safe and secure nesting environment for birds.

Choosing the Right Tree

Birds are selective when it comes to choosing the tree in which they will build their nest. They look for certain characteristics that provide stability and protection. Trees with strong branches and a sturdy trunk are preferred, as they offer a solid foundation for the nest. Additionally, birds often choose trees with dense foliage, as this provides ample coverage from predators and harsh weather conditions.

Assessing the Tree’s Health

Before choosing a tree for nesting, birds assess its health to ensure a suitable habitat. They look for signs of disease or decay, such as rotting branches or visible damage. A healthy tree is more likely to provide a secure nesting site that will withstand the test of time. Birds are instinctively drawn to trees that show no signs of weakness or vulnerability.

Selecting a Suitable Location

Once a bird has chosen a tree, it must then select a suitable location within that tree for its nest. Birds often consider factors such as exposure to sunlight, wind, and rain. They prefer locations that offer some degree of protection from the elements, such as the canopy of the tree or a well-sheltered branch. Additionally, birds take into account the proximity to food sources and potential nesting predators when selecting a location.

Nest Construction Process

Gathering Nesting Materials

When it comes to building a nest in a tree, one of the first steps for birds is to gather the necessary nesting materials. Different bird species have different preferences, but common materials include twigs, leaves, grass, moss, feathers, and even bits of string or human-made materials they find in their surroundings. Birds have a keen eye for selecting the right materials that will provide durability and insulation. They carefully choose items that will help to create a comfortable and secure home for their future offspring.

Creating the Foundation

After gathering the nesting materials, birds begin the process of creating the foundation of their nest. This involves carefully arranging and interweaving the twigs and other materials to form a sturdy base. The foundation needs to be solid enough to support the weight of the nest and the growing chicks, as well as withstand any weather conditions that may arise. Birds use their beaks and feet to shape and mold the materials, ensuring a snug fit and a stable structure.

Weaving the Nest Walls

Once the foundation is in place, birds move on to the next step: weaving the nest walls. This is where their remarkable craftsmanship comes into play. Using their beaks and feet, birds intricately weave and intertwine the nesting materials to form a cup-shaped structure. The walls are carefully constructed to provide protection and insulation for the eggs and later the hatchlings. The level of intricacy and precision in the weaving process varies depending on the bird species, but all birds exhibit a remarkable ability to create a safe and comfortable environment for their young.

Nesting Behavior

Incubation Period

Birds engage in a fascinating process known as incubation, during which the eggs are kept warm and the embryos develop. The incubation period varies among different bird species, with some lasting as short as 10 days and others as long as 80 days. This period is critical for the survival of the eggs and the successful hatching of the chicks.

During incubation, the parent birds take turns sitting on the eggs to provide the necessary warmth. The eggs require a specific temperature for proper development, and the parents carefully regulate this by adjusting their body position and feather fluffing. The warmth generated by their bodies helps to maintain the ideal temperature within the nest.

Parental Nesting Duties

Once the eggs have hatched, the responsibilities of the parent birds shift towards caring for their young. Both parents play an important role in providing food, protection, and guidance to the chicks. This division of labor allows for efficient parenting and increases the chances of the chicks’ survival.

One of the main duties of the parents is to feed the hungry chicks. They tirelessly search for food, often making multiple trips to and from the nest throughout the day. The diet of the chicks varies depending on the bird species, but it usually consists of insects, small invertebrates, seeds, or fruits. The parents may catch and kill prey or gather food from their surroundings to bring back to the nest.

In addition to feeding, the parents also clean and maintain the nest. They remove any debris or waste that accumulates, ensuring a clean and healthy environment for their offspring. This cleanliness is essential to prevent the spread of diseases or parasites that could harm the chicks.

Furthermore, the parents provide warmth and protection to the chicks. They use their bodies to shield the young from harsh weather conditions, predators, and other potential dangers. Their presence in the nest offers a sense of security and reassurance to the vulnerable chicks.

Nest Defense Strategies

Nesting birds face numerous threats, including predators, parasites, and rival birds. To ensure the safety of their nest and offspring, birds employ various defense strategies.

One common defense strategy is camouflage. Some bird species build their nests in a way that blends seamlessly with their surroundings, making it difficult for predators to locate them. The choice of materials and the placement of the nest are crucial for achieving this camouflage effect.

Other birds rely on distraction techniques to divert the attention of predators away from the nest. They may feign injury or use vocalizations to draw the predator away, allowing the chicks to remain safe and hidden. This deceptive behavior aims to protect the vulnerable young and increase their chances of survival.

Certain bird species also exhibit territorial behavior to defend their nests. They vigorously defend their nesting area, chasing away any intruders that come too close. This territorial aggression serves as a warning to potential threats, signaling that the nest is occupied and protected.

In some cases, birds may form alliances with other individuals of the same species or even different species to enhance nest defense. This collaborative effort increases the effectiveness of defense strategies and reduces the risk of predation.


Benefits of Nests in Trees

Protection from Predators

When birds build their nests in trees, they benefit from the natural protection that the tree’s height and structure provide. Predators such as snakes, raccoons, and squirrels find it difficult to reach the nests, reducing the risk of eggs or chicks being eaten. The branches and leaves of the tree create a barrier, making it harder for predators to spot the nest. This protection gives birds a safe and secure environment to raise their young.

Enhanced Nest Visibility

Nesting in trees also offers birds the advantage of enhanced nest visibility. By building their nests in a tree, birds can position them at a height that allows for better visibility and a wider field of view. This increased visibility helps the birds spot potential threats or predators approaching the nest from a distance. It also allows them to keep an eye on their surroundings, making it easier to find food sources and identify suitable mates.

Access to Food Sources

One of the key benefits of nesting in trees is the availability of food sources. Trees attract a wide variety of insects, fruits, and seeds, which in turn attract birds. By building their nests in trees, birds have easy access to these food sources, saving them valuable time and energy. They can quickly fly out from their nests to find insects or feed on the fruits and seeds that the tree provides. This proximity to food ensures that the parent birds have a consistent supply of nourishment to feed their chicks, promoting their growth and development.

Common Tree Nesting Birds

American Robin

The American Robin, scientifically known as Turdus migratorius, is a well-known and beloved bird species that commonly builds its nest in trees. With its iconic red breast and melodic song, the American Robin is a familiar sight in many North American backyards.

  • The American Robin typically chooses trees with dense foliage, such as deciduous trees, for their nests. These trees provide good protection and camouflage for the nest.
  • The nest of an American Robin is typically cup-shaped and constructed using a combination of mud, grass, twigs, and other plant materials. The female robin takes the lead in nest building, while the male assists by providing materials.
  • Incubation of the eggs is primarily carried out by the female robin, although the male may also take turns. The incubation period lasts around 12-14 days, after which the eggs hatch into hungry chicks.
  • Once the chicks hatch, both parents are actively involved in feeding and caring for them. They tirelessly search for insects, worms, and berries to feed their young, ensuring their healthy growth and development.
  • The American Robin also employs various nest defense strategies to protect its nest from potential predators. These strategies include dive-bombing, vocal alarms, and aggressive displays to deter threats.

Northern Cardinal

The Northern Cardinal, scientifically known as Cardinalis cardinalis, is another tree-nesting bird that captivates with its vibrant red plumage and distinctive crest. Its melodious song and striking appearance make it a favorite among birdwatchers.

  • The Northern Cardinal typically selects shrubs and small trees, such as dense bushes or thickets, as nesting sites. These locations provide adequate cover and protection for the nest.
  • The nest of a Northern Cardinal is built by the female, using a combination of twigs, leaves, grass, and bark strips. The male assists by providing materials and occasionally contributes to the construction process.
  • Incubation of the eggs is primarily the responsibility of the female cardinal, while the male provides food and stands guard. The incubation period usually lasts around 11-13 days, after which the eggs hatch.
  • Both parents are actively involved in raising the chicks, with the male continuing to provide food for the growing nestlings. The chicks fledge in about 7-13 days and become independent shortly thereafter.
  • The Northern Cardinal is known for its distinctive crest and vibrant red plumage, which helps enhance its nest visibility. This visibility allows other cardinals to identify the nesting pair and serves as a form of communication within the species.

Bald Eagle

The Bald Eagle, scientifically known as Haliaeetus leucocephalus, is a majestic bird of prey that constructs its nest in large trees. With its impressive size and powerful presence, the Bald Eagle is an iconic symbol of strength and freedom.

  • The Bald Eagle typically selects tall and sturdy trees near bodies of water as nesting sites. These sites provide a strategic advantage for hunting and offer protection for the nest.
  • The nest of a Bald Eagle is called an “eyrie” and is one of the largest nests built by any bird species. It is constructed using a combination of sticks, branches, grass, and moss. Over time, the nest can grow to immense proportions, reaching several feet in diameter and weighing thousands of pounds.
  • Incubation of the eggs is shared by both the male and female eagles. The incubation period lasts around 34-36 days, after which the eggs hatch into vulnerable eaglets.
  • The parental nesting duties of Bald Eagles are extensive. Both parents provide food for the eaglets, protect them from predators, and teach them essential survival skills. The eaglets stay in the nest for several months before they are ready to fledge.
  • Nest defense strategies of the Bald Eagle primarily involve the parents’ territorial behavior and aerial displays. They fiercely protect their nest and young from potential threats, including other eagles and predators.

Tree Nesting Challenges

Competition for Nesting Sites

Nesting in trees can be a competitive endeavor for birds. With limited suitable tree cavities and nesting sites available, birds often have to compete with each other for these prime locations. The competition can be fierce, as birds seek out the safest and most secure spots to build their nests and raise their young.

One common example of competition for nesting sites is among cavity-nesting birds, such as woodpeckers and chickadees. These birds rely on tree cavities for nesting, but these cavities are not always readily available. Other bird species or even squirrels may also be vying for the same tree cavities, leading to intense competition.

To gain an advantage in the competition for nesting sites, birds may engage in various behaviors. They may defend their chosen spot aggressively, using vocalizations, displays, and even physical interactions. Some birds, like bluebirds, may even engage in “site prospecting,” where they scout out multiple potential nesting sites before making a final decision.

Extreme Weather Conditions

Birds face the challenge of extreme weather conditions when nesting in trees. Trees can offer some protection from the elements, but they are not completely immune to the effects of harsh weather. Strong winds, heavy rainfall, and even storms can pose risks to both the nest and the birds themselves.

For example, during strong winds, the branches of the tree can sway, potentially dislodging the nest or causing damage to the fragile structure. Heavy rainfall can also saturate the nesting materials, making the nest damp and uncomfortable for the birds. In extreme cases, storms can even cause trees to topple, leading to the loss of the nest and endangering the birds’ safety.

To mitigate the challenges posed by extreme weather, birds may choose tree species that are more resilient to strong winds or have denser foliage to provide better protection from rain. They may also reinforce their nests with additional materials or make repairs after storms to ensure their nests remain intact.

Human Disturbance

While trees can offer a natural refuge for nesting birds, human activities can pose significant challenges and disturbances. As humans continue to expand into natural habitats, the presence of people can disrupt the nesting behavior of birds and potentially lead to nest failure.

Activities such as construction, logging, and even recreational activities near nesting sites can cause disturbance and stress to birds. The noise and movement associated with these activities can disrupt the birds’ ability to incubate their eggs or care for their young. In some cases, the disturbance may be severe enough to cause abandonment of the nest altogether.

It is essential for humans to be aware of the potential impacts of their actions on nesting birds and take steps to minimize disturbance. This can include avoiding nesting areas during breeding seasons, establishing protected areas, and providing alternative nesting sites such as birdhouses or artificial nest platforms.
